In effective self-assessment, the quality of guidance and support is evaluated by the extent to which...
| 4.3 | careers education and guidance are effective in guiding learners towards opportunities available to them when they have completed their studies or training. |
Success in adult literacy, numeracy and ESOL provision in the learning difficulties and/or disabilities context means...
| 4.3.1 | staff help learners to start planning for their next placements from the time they commence their courses or programmes. |
| 4.3.2 | staff are knowledgeable about the literacy, numeracy and language requirements of programmes and placements that are available for learners when they have completed their studies. |
| 4.3.3 | where necessary, learners have access to specialist advice and guidance to help them make realistic choices about their next placements. |
